Crypto-Gram Security Podcast is the audio version of the Crypto-Gram Newsletter by security expert Bruce Schneier. Each issue is filled with interesting commentary, pointed critique, and serious debate about security. As head curmudgeon at the table, Schneier explains, debunks, and draws lessons from security stories that make the news. It is read by Dan Henage.
